• Improve Indico’s technical security posture across AWS, Kubernetes, CI/CD, product security, internal systems, and incident response. • Partner with the CISO and CTO to turn security priorities into practical technical controls, standards, reviews, and operating processes. • Review Engineering work against security standards, with authority to request changes where needed. • Partner with Engineering on AWS security controls, including IAM, networking, account structure, logging, encryption, key management, backups, production access, and customer-dedicated environments. • Review and improve Kubernetes and container security controls, including workload identity, RBAC, network boundaries, image security, runtime monitoring, and deployment patterns. • Define and improve secure CI/CD patterns, including GitHub permissions, branch protections, privileged workflows, secrets handling, release controls, and deployment access. • Define and oversee processes for vulnerability management, committed-secret response, secure development, incident response, and access control while Engineering, Platform, IT/Ops, and system owners operate them in their domains. • Provide product security support, including secure design review, threat modeling for sensitive features, scanner tuning, and high-risk change review. • Improve detection and response coverage across tools such as CloudTrail, GuardDuty, CrowdStrike, SIEM/logging platforms, vulnerability scanners, and secrets detection. • Own day-to-day security monitoring and response operations, including alert routing, triage expectations, escalation paths, and detection improvements. • Coordinate technical containment during security incidents across Engineering, Platform, IT/Ops, and leadership. • Maintain incident response runbooks and partner with the CISO on severity, executive escalation, counsel/compliance coordination, and customer communication strategy. • Create practical security guidance, standards, procedures, and runbooks for security-sensitive work such as production access, secrets handling, vulnerability remediation, incident response, customer data handling, and secure engineering. • Maintain reusable technical security documentation, standard responses, and evidence packages for customer due diligence and compliance support. • Evaluate security tools and vendors with a focus on technical coverage, operational fit, and reducing manual work. • Build or sponsor lightweight automation, checks, dashboards, and workflows that make security controls repeatable.
